FHIR © HL7.org  |  Server Home  |  XIG Home  |  Server Source  |  FHIR  

FHIR IG Statistics: StructureDefinition/RFR

Packagehl7.v2plus
TypeStructureDefinition
IdRFR
FHIR VersionR5
Sourcehttp://somewhere.org/fhir/uv/v2plus/https://build.fhir.org/ig/HL7/v2ig/StructureDefinition-RFR.html
URLhttp://hl7.org/v2/StructureDefinition/RFR
Version0.0.0
Statusactive
Date2025-07-11T16:45:01+00:00
NameRFR
TitleHL7 v2 RFR Data Type
Authorityhl7
Description*Note:* Replaces the CM data type used in sections 8.8.4.6 - OM2-6, 8.8.4.7 - OM2-7 and 8.8.4.8 - OM2-8 as of v 2.5. Examples: {empty}a) A range that applies unconditionally, such as albumin, is transmitted as: |3.0&5.5| {empty}b) A normal range that depends on sex, such as Hgb, is transmitted as: |13.5&18^M~12.0 & 16^F| {empty}c) A normal range that depends on age, sex, and race (a concocted example) is: |10&13^M^0&2^^^B11&13.5^M^2&20^^^B~12&14.5^M^20&70^^^B~13&16.0^M^70&^^^B| When no value is specified for a particular component, the range given applies to all categories of that component. For example, when nothing is specified for race/species, the range should be taken as the human range without regard to race. If no age range is specified, the normal range given is assumed to apply to all ages.
Typehttp://hl7.org/v2/StructureDefinition/RFR
Kindlogical

Resources that use this resource

No resources found


Resources that this resource uses

StructureDefinition
CWEHL7 v2 CWE Data Type
NRHL7 v2 NR Data Type
STHL7 v2 String Primitive Type
TXHL7 v2 TX Data Type
complex-data-typeHL7 v2 Complex Data Type

Narrative

Note: links and images are rebased to the (stated) source

Generated Narrative: StructureDefinition RFR

NameFlagsCard.TypeDescription & Constraintsdoco
.. RFR 0..*V2ComplexDataTypereference range
... 1 1..1NRNumeric Range
... 2 0..1CWESex
Binding: http://terminology.hl7.org/ValueSet/v2-0828 (required)
... 3 0..1NRAge Range
... 4 0..1NRGestational Age Range
... 5 0..1stringSpecies
... 6 0..1stringRace/subspecies
... 7 0..1stringConditions

doco Documentation for this format

Source

{
  "resourceType": "StructureDefinition",
  "id": "RFR",
  "meta": {
    "profile": [
      "http://hl7.org/v2/StructureDefinition/complex-data-type-profile"
    ]
  },
  "text": {
    "status": "extensions",
    "div": "<!-- snip (see above) -->"
  },
  "extension": [
    {
      "url": "http://hl7.org/fhir/StructureDefinition/structuredefinition-standards-status",
      "valueCode": "informative",
      "_valueCode": {
        "extension": [
          {
            "url": "http://hl7.org/fhir/StructureDefinition/structuredefinition-conformance-derivedFrom",
            "valueCanonical": "http://somewhere.org/fhir/uv/v2plus/ImplementationGuide/hl7.other.uv.v2plus"
          }
        ]
      }
    }
  ],
  "url": "http://hl7.org/v2/StructureDefinition/RFR",
  "version": "0.0.0",
  "name": "RFR",
  "title": "HL7 v2 RFR Data Type",
  "status": "active",
  "date": "2025-07-11T16:45:01+00:00",
  "publisher": "HL7 International",
  "contact": [
    {
      "telecom": [
        {
          "system": "url",
          "value": "http://hl7.org/Special/committees/v2mgmt"
        }
      ]
    }
  ],
  "description": "*Note:* Replaces the CM data type used in sections 8.8.4.6 - OM2-6, 8.8.4.7 - OM2-7 and 8.8.4.8 - OM2-8 as of v 2.5.\n\nExamples:\n\n{empty}a) A range that applies unconditionally, such as albumin, is transmitted as:\n\n|3.0&5.5|\n\n{empty}b) A normal range that depends on sex, such as Hgb, is transmitted as:\n\n|13.5&18^M~12.0 & 16^F|\n\n{empty}c) A normal range that depends on age, sex, and race (a concocted example) is:\n\n|10&13^M^0&2^^^B11&13.5^M^2&20^^^B~12&14.5^M^20&70^^^B~13&16.0^M^70&^^^B|\n\nWhen no value is specified for a particular component, the range given applies to all categories of that component. For example, when nothing is specified for race/species, the range should be taken as the human range without regard to race. If no age range is specified, the normal range given is assumed to apply to all ages.",
  "fhirVersion": "5.0.0",
  "mapping": [
    {
      "identity": "rim",
      "uri": "http://hl7.org/v3",
      "name": "RIM Mapping"
    }
  ],
  "kind": "logical",
  "abstract": false,
  "type": "http://hl7.org/v2/StructureDefinition/RFR",
  "baseDefinition": "http://hl7.org/v2/StructureDefinition/complex-data-type",
  "derivation": "specialization",
  "snapshot": {
    "extension": [
      {
        "url": "http://hl7.org/fhir/tools/StructureDefinition/snapshot-base-version",
        "valueString": "0.0.0"
      }
    ],
    "element": [
      {
        "id": "RFR",
        "path": "RFR",
        "short": "reference range",
        "definition": "Definition: Describes a reference range and its supporting detail.",
        "min": 0,
        "max": "*",
        "base": {
          "path": "Base",
          "min": 0,
          "max": "*"
        },
        "isModifier": false,
        "mapping": [
          {
            "identity": "rim",
            "map": "n/a"
          }
        ]
      },
      {
        "id": "RFR.1",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"R"
          }
        ],
        "path": "RFR.1",
        "short": "Numeric Range",
        "min": 1,
        "max": "1",
        "base": {
          "path": "RFR.1",
          "min": 1,
          "max": "1"
        },
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/NR"
          }
        ]
      },
      {
        "id": "RFR.2",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          }
        ],
        "path": "RFR.2",
        "short": "Sex",
        "min": 0,
        "max": "1",
        "base": {
          "path": "RFR.2",
          "min": 0,
          "max": "1"
        },
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/CWE"
          }
        ],
        "binding": {
          "strength": "required",
          "valueSet": "http://terminology.hl7.org/ValueSet/v2-0828"
        }
      },
      {
        "id": "RFR.3",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          }
        ],
        "path": "RFR.3",
        "short": "Age Range",
        "min": 0,
        "max": "1",
        "base": {
          "path": "RFR.3",
          "min": 0,
          "max": "1"
        },
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/NR"
          }
        ]
      },
      {
        "id": "RFR.4",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          }
        ],
        "path": "RFR.4",
        "short": "Gestational Age Range",
        "min": 0,
        "max": "1",
        "base": {
          "path": "RFR.4",
          "min": 0,
          "max": "1"
        },
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/NR"
          }
        ]
      },
      {
        "id": "RFR.5",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          },
          {
            "extension": [
              {
                "url": "length",
                "valueInteger": 20
              },
              {
                "url": "noTruncate",
                "valueBoolean": true
              }
            ],
            "url": "http://hl7.org/v2/StructureDefinition/conformance-length"
          }
        ],
        "path": "RFR.5",
        "short": "Species",
        "min": 0,
        "max": "1",
        "base": {
          "path": "RFR.5",
          "min": 0,
          "max": "1"
        },
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/ST"
          }
        ]
      },
      {
        "id": "RFR.6",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          },
          {
            "extension": [
              {
                "url": "length",
                "valueInteger": 20
              },
              {
                "url": "noTruncate",
                "valueBoolean": true
              }
            ],
            "url": "http://hl7.org/v2/StructureDefinition/conformance-length"
          }
        ],
        "path": "RFR.6",
        "short": "Race/subspecies",
        "min": 0,
        "max": "1",
        "base": {
          "path": "RFR.6",
          "min": 0,
          "max": "1"
        },
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/ST"
          }
        ]
      },
      {
        "id": "RFR.7",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          }
        ],
        "path": "RFR.7",
        "short": "Conditions",
        "min": 0,
        "max": "1",
        "base": {
          "path": "RFR.7",
          "min": 0,
          "max": "1"
        },
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/TX"
          }
        ]
      }
    ]
  },
  "differential": {
    "element": [
      {
        "id": "RFR",
        "path": "RFR",
        "short": "reference range",
        "definition": "Definition: Describes a reference range and its supporting detail.",
        "min": 0,
        "max": "*"
      },
      {
        "id": "RFR.1",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"R"
          }
        ],
        "path": "RFR.1",
        "short": "Numeric Range",
        "min": 1,
        "max": "1",
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/NR"
          }
        ]
      },
      {
        "id": "RFR.2",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          }
        ],
        "path": "RFR.2",
        "short": "Sex",
        "min": 0,
        "max": "1",
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/CWE"
          }
        ],
        "binding": {
          "strength": "required",
          "valueSet": "http://terminology.hl7.org/ValueSet/v2-0828"
        }
      },
      {
        "id": "RFR.3",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          }
        ],
        "path": "RFR.3",
        "short": "Age Range",
        "min": 0,
        "max": "1",
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/NR"
          }
        ]
      },
      {
        "id": "RFR.4",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          }
        ],
        "path": "RFR.4",
        "short": "Gestational Age Range",
        "min": 0,
        "max": "1",
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/NR"
          }
        ]
      },
      {
        "id": "RFR.5",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          },
          {
            "extension": [
              {
                "url": "length",
                "valueInteger": 20
              },
              {
                "url": "noTruncate",
                "valueBoolean": true
              }
            ],
            "url": "http://hl7.org/v2/StructureDefinition/conformance-length"
          }
        ],
        "path": "RFR.5",
        "short": "Species",
        "min": 0,
        "max": "1",
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/ST"
          }
        ]
      },
      {
        "id": "RFR.6",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          },
          {
            "extension": [
              {
                "url": "length",
                "valueInteger": 20
              },
              {
                "url": "noTruncate",
                "valueBoolean": true
              }
            ],
            "url": "http://hl7.org/v2/StructureDefinition/conformance-length"
          }
        ],
        "path": "RFR.6",
        "short": "Race/subspecies",
        "min": 0,
        "max": "1",
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/ST"
          }
        ]
      },
      {
        "id": "RFR.7",
        "extension": [
          {
            "url": "http://hl7.org/v2/StructureDefinition/optionality",
            "valueCode": "O"
          }
        ],
        "path": "RFR.7",
        "short": "Conditions",
        "min": 0,
        "max": "1",
        "type": [
          {
            "code": "http://hl7.org/v2/StructureDefinition/TX"
          }
        ]
      }
    ]
  }
}